Nanotyrannus

$0.00

(Late Cretaceous)

The Nanotyrannus is a newly confirmed genus of therapod dinosaur that lived alongside the Tyrannosaurus Rex at the end of the Cretaceous period. For years, scientists debated over whether this smaller was a teenage T. Rex or its own distinct species. In 2025, the researchers at North Carolina Museum of Natural Sciences determined that the theropod in their famous fossil “The Dueling Dinosaurs” was full grown at the time of death. This discovery settled the debate once and for all. Now that the two species are officially split, our understanding of both the Nanotyrannus and the T. Rex are forever changed.
